Berkeley Boot Camps offer 12-week, full-time and 24-week, part-time courses in web development; 24-week, part-time courses in data analytics, UX/UI, cybersecurity and financial technology (FinTech) and 18-week, part-time digital marketing and technology project management courses. Berkeley Boot Camps Alumni Reviews Summary

Based on 60+ Berkeley Boot Camps reviews on Course Report, alumni praise this school for their comprehensive curriculum, expert instruction, and strong support system. Students appreciate the broad range of tools and technologies covered, flexibility for remote learning, and the boot camp's alignment with industry needs. One reviewer states: "I’m so happy and satisfied that I choose the Berkeley Bootcamp, the support to the students even online is amazing." However, some students point out that the fast-paced nature of Berkeley Boot Camps may not be ideal for beginners​​.

How much does Berkeley Boot Camps cost?

Berkeley Boot Camps costs around $14,495. On the lower end, some Berkeley Boot Camps courses like Digital Marketing - Part-Time cost $9,995.

What courses does Berkeley Boot Camps teach?

Berkeley Boot Camps offers courses like Cybersecurity - Part-Time, Data Science and Visualization - Part-Time, Digital Marketing - Part-Time, Full Stack Web Development - Full-Time and 2 more.

Where does Berkeley Boot Camps have campuses?

Berkeley Boot Camps has an in-person campus in San Francisco.
